ALEXANDRIA, Va., April 15 -- United States Patent no. 12,601,749, issued on April 14, was assigned to BANYAN BIOMARKERS INC. (Durham, N.C.).

"Biomarker detection process and assay of neurological condition" was invented by Kevin Ka-Wang Wang (Gainesville, Fla.), Ronald L. Hayes (Alachua, Fla.), Uwe R. Mueller (Alachua, Fla.) and Zhiqun Zhang (Auburndale, Mass.).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A robust, quantitative, and reproducible process and assay for diagnosis of a neurological condition in a subject.
